Decomposers play a crucial role in nature by:
1. Breaking down organic matter: Decomposers like bacteria, fungi, and insects convert dead plants and animals into simple nutrients.
2. Recycling nutrients: Decomposers release nutrients like carbon, nitrogen, and phosphorus back into the ecosystem, supporting new growth.
3. Maintaining ecosystem balance: Decomposers help regulate the flow of nutrients, preventing excesses or deficiencies that could harm the ecosystem.
4. Supporting nutrient cycles: Decomposers facilitate nutrient cycles, like the carbon cycle, nitrogen cycle, and phosphorus cycle.
5. Facilitating soil formation: Decomposers help create and maintain healthy soil structure and fertility.
6. Influencing ecosystem processes: Decomposers affect ecosystem processes like primary production, respiration, and energy flow.
7. Supporting biodiversity: Decomposers contribute to habitat diversity, supporting a wide range of plant and animal species.
8. Mitigating disease and pollution: Decomposers can break down pathogens and pollutants, reducing their impact on the ecosystem.
Decomposers are essential for ecosystem functioning, and their activities underpin the health and fertility of ecosystems.
